Comprehending Composite Doors

Composite doors are made from a mix of products, including wood, PVC, and insulating foam. This multi-layered style not only boosts security however likewise enhances thermal performance, while supplying excellent weather condition resistance. Q1: How long do composite doors usually last?

Composite doors are understood for their sturdiness and can last anywhere from 30 to 50 years, depending upon the quality of materials used and the level of maintenance.

Q2: Can I set up a composite door myself?

While it is possible to set up a composite door yourself, it is suggested to work with a professional for best outcomes. Incorrect installation can jeopardize security, insulation, and general functionality.

Q3: Are composite doors energy-efficient?

Yes, composite doors are extremely energy-efficient due to their insulating properties, assisting to keep homes warm in winter season and cool in summertime.

Q4: What maintenance do composite doors need?

Composite doors need very little maintenance. Routine cleansing with moderate soap and water is generally adequate, and periodic checks of the seals and locking systems are a good idea.
